Ok, I admit it! I was a chess nut when I was growing up and I don’t mean the kind that grows on trees.

I mean the game of chess and it’s still one of the most challenging games ever created.

But since I haven’t actively played the game for years, I went on a search for resources that could help me regain some confidence in playing.

One of the best sites that I found was called Chessacademy.com because it presented lessons in a fun and easy to understand way.

If you don’t know a rook from a pawn or you’re a regular player looking to build new strategies, Chessacademy.com is a great resource.

A 7-time world champion joined forces with a couple of tech wizards to create lots of free online video lessons that can teach anyone how to play chess.

Once you feel like you’ve learned enough to give it a go, you can click on the Train option to work with specific scenarios to gain strategic knowledge.

If you’ve ever wanted to become a chess nerd, I can’t think of a better place to start than Chessacademy.com
